Last night I finally decided to update the code on the Kiss, it was sitting at v1.28 ..everything seemed to go fine and when I restarted I got the dreaded message ‘This machine will not play in your country’ 😭because as you know it’s a US game, why didn’t I just leave it, the joys of buying from abroad.

So I was talking to the guy who designed the mod board and he told me to try and downgrade the code but I don’t have the older code 😕he also went on to say that Stern had made his boards obsolete with the code update and hasn’t had time to work on it, so now I have an expensive paperweight 😂

Thanks for the reply.

It's not a voltage problem as the power is auto switching, its to do with 50/60hz and that's what the board does.
